Question

Je développe des plugins pour mon application en utilisant la technologie JEDI Plugin, mais je rencontre de nombreux problèmes avec le partage de mémoire, en particulier lorsqu'il gère la connexion à une base de données. L'application principale utilise le gestionnaire de mémoire FASTMM4. Est-ce que quelqu'un connaît un cadre un peu plus facile pour travailler avec des plugins?

Était-ce utile?

La solution

Le gestionnaire de plug-ins JVCL fonctionne très bien, mais si vous souhaitez partager correctement la mémoire avec vos plug-ins, vous devez ajouter SimpleShareMem.pas à la clause uses de votre application et des plug-ins, en haut de la liste des utilisations, dans le fichier de projet.

Autres conseils

Est-ce que vos plugins utilisent également FASTMM4? Vous devez vous assurer que vous utilisez le même gestionnaire de mémoire dans l'application et le plug-in.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top